I have the privilege of working in the Denver Support Center as a Retreat Specialist. In this role, I get to work with other FOCUS missionaries all over the country and support them, love them, and empower them to facilitate a retreat for the people they are serving.
Growing up, my parents didn’t just talk to me about the faith, they lived it out by serving the church. Being able to witness what God can do with a continual yes moved me, and I was shown what it looked like to make disciples of all nations at a very early age.
As I got older, my desire to serve the Lord in ministry grew. When I was a freshman at Franciscan University, I felt the Lord start putting specific desires on my heart for how to serve Him. Firstly, He gave me a desire to work with college-aged students, and secondly, to serve those who were serving others.
Now, 6 years later, the Lord provided this opportunity with the Retreats team where I am able to live out these desires. I get to walk along-side missionaries and help them facilitate environments of encounter with God through FOCUS Retreats.
